of Leeds

of Hounslow (1974)

c.1919 Public company incorporated[1]

1939 Managing Director John Goldwell Ambrose

1955 36th AGM. Maker of Bison precast concrete floors[2]

1962 Announced Bison system of construction of high rise flats using concrete panels[3]

1963 Acquired Concrete Development Co from Holland and Hannen and Cubitts[4]

1965 Appointed sub-contractors for industrialised building in construction of the University of Surrey[5]

1965 The company claimed to have built 2,200 dwellings using the Bison Wall Frame system, many more than most of the competing industrialised building systems[6]

1969 Acquired Banister, Walton and Co Ltd[7]

1970 Concrete tried to counteract the negative attitude towards system building following the collapse of the Ronan Point flats - released test data which showed the Bison system would be satisfactory provided the walls were properly tied into the structure[8]

1976 Concrete Ltd of Leeds acquired Dowsett Engineering Construction and subsequently Dowsett Piling and Foundations[9]

1977 Name changed to Bison Group. Concrete was acquired by National Chemical Industries of Saudi Arabia[10]

1978 Sold Dowsett Piling and Foundations to WGI Group[11]
